Commit Graph

21 Commits (131f4b7672befbc6824f2691c308d713a4c0b8a3)

Author SHA1 Message Date
weidai 131f4b7672 fix EC2N skipping of optional seed, switch to public domain MARS code, deliver vc80.pdb to OutDir 2009-03-28 03:08:27 +00:00
weidai bce3c6544a fix compile on MSVC 6 2009-03-13 02:55:23 +00:00
weidai 064fd62ec5 - add EAX mode, XSalsa20
- speed up GCM key setup
- wipe stack in AES assembly code
- speed up CFB mode
2009-03-12 11:24:12 +00:00
weidai b0e8eb60ce add x86/x64 assembly for SHA-256,
add DEFAULT_CHANNEL and AAD_CHANNEL,
fix macChannel for AuthenticatedEncryptionFilter
2009-03-10 02:56:19 +00:00
weidai ae9e6e0b22 fix bug when AuthenticatedDecryptionFilter::MAC_AT_BEGIN is not specified 2009-03-05 08:53:50 +00:00
weidai 69b85d0724 tweaks/fixes for 5.6 2009-03-03 03:28:39 +00:00
weidai e30273241d changes for 5.6:
- added AuthenticatedSymmetricCipher interface class and Filter wrappers
    - added CCM, GCM (with SSE2 assembly), CMAC, and SEED
    - improved AES speed on x86 and x64
    - removed WORD64_AVAILABLE; compiler 64-bit int support is now required
2009-03-02 02:39:17 +00:00
weidai 65920f7dc4 fix compile for x64, DLL and VC 6 2007-05-04 15:24:09 +00:00
weidai 0b452062f3 Test: Encode now tests decryption also 2007-04-16 00:39:56 +00:00
weidai e223bee447 port to Borland C++Builder 2006 2006-12-14 11:41:39 +00:00
weidai e5689a799a port to GCC 4, reorganize implementations of SetKey 2006-12-10 02:12:23 +00:00
weidai 693f813be9 add Salsa20 cipher 2006-12-09 17:18:13 +00:00
weidai f459aab26f additional AES test vectors 2006-07-17 14:49:51 +00:00
weidai cafc0c242d fix MSVC 2005 warnings 2006-03-13 13:26:41 +00:00
weidai a1d2b8163c add XTEA and BTEA 2003-07-30 00:28:54 +00:00
weidai b022c27ee9 misc changes 2003-07-18 04:35:30 +00:00
weidai 04145c394c fix bugs in SEAL and Panama 2003-03-26 21:50:44 +00:00
weidai bf8c9a23a9 small fixes 2003-03-20 21:09:10 +00:00
weidai 979c2038ca fix warnings for VC7 and GCC 2003-03-20 20:39:59 +00:00
weidai a12a3534fa various changes for 5.1 2003-03-20 01:24:12 +00:00
weidai 605b897ee9 add script-driven testing 2002-12-06 22:02:46 +00:00